Colin Selby keeps pitching well, home runs by Jase Bowen and Sammy Siani, and more Pittsburgh Pirates minor league action

Strong pitching carried Triple-A Indianapolis to a 3-1 victory over the St. Paul Saints on Saturday night. With the win, the top farm club of the Pittsburgh Pirates is now 17-20 on the season.

Lefty Kent Emanuel started for Indy and pitched 4 innings. Emanuel allowed a run on four hits, a walk, and four strikeouts. The run that he allowed came on a solo home run. This was a much needed strong outing for Emanuel who has struggled to the tune of an 8.15 ERA this season.

Cody Bolton followed Emanuel. While Bolton allowed a pair of hits and walked a batter, he still pitched a scoreless 5th inning. Eli Villalobos pitched a scoreless 6th inning, Angel Perdomo then walked a pair and struck out two in 2 scoreless innings pitched.

Colin Selby got the ball in the 9th and slammed the door shut. Selby struck out a pair in a 1-2-3 9th inning striking out a pair. Sleby now owns a 3.00 ERA and a 9:19 BB:K ratio in 15 innings pitched this season.

Nick Gonzales went 1-for-4 with a walk and a run scored at the top of the Indy lineup. Endy Rodriguez was 1-for-2 with a walk, Cal Mitchell was 1-for-2 with a walk, a run scored, and a RBI. Mark Mathais served as designated hitter and went 1-for-3 with a RBI.

Altoona hangs on for 1-run victory

They allowed a run in the 8th inning that made them sweat it out some, but the Double-A Altoona Curve defeated the Akron RubberDucks 5-4 on Saturday night. With the win, the Curve are now 15-15 on the season.

Liover Peguero went 1-for-5 with a RBI, left fielder Fabricio Macias was also 1-for-5. Henry Davis started at catcher and actually looked human, going just 1-for-4 with a walk. He still has an Eastern League best 1.126 OPS.

Lolo Sanchez was 1-for-4 with a solo home run, his 3rd of the season. Andres Alvarez was 2-for-4 with a RBI and two runs scored. Matt Fraizer was 3-for-4 with three doubles, he drove in a pair and scored a run.

Kyle Nicolas started for the Curve and pitched 5 strong innings. He allowed a run on six hits, three walks, and five strikeouts. Brad Case allowed 2 runs on two hits and a walk in 2/3 of an inning pitched. Tahnaj Thomas allowed a run in 2 innings pitched while striking out a pair.

Oliver Garcia pitched 1/3 of an inning. Tyler Samaniego pitched a scoreless 9th inning for his 2nd save of the season, allowing a hit and issuing a walk.

Loss for High-A Greensboro

Saturday night the High-A Greensboro Grasshoppers fell to the Jersey Shore BlueClaws 9-5. With the loss, the Grasshoppers are now 20-12 on the season. Despite the loss, the Grasshoppers still have the best record in the Pirate farm system.

Starting at second base Tsung-Che Cheng went 1-for-4 with a double and a walk at the top of Greensboro's lineup. Tres Gonzalez and Mike Jarvis were both 1-for-5, Gonzales scored a run and Jarvis drove in a run.

Jase Bowen and Sammy Siani both hit home runs for the Grasshoppers. It was the 7th long ball of the season for Bowen and the 4th for Siani. Third baseman Ernny Ordonez went 2-for-4.

Bubba Chandler started for Greensboro and got roughed up. Chandler allowed 6 runs on six hits, two walks, a home run, and three strikeouts. Michell Milian followed Chandler, allowing 2 runs o nthree hits and three walks in 1.1 innings pitched.

Mitchell Miller allowed run in 2 innings pitched. Oliver Mateo walked three and struck out a pair in a scoreless inning pitched. Jaycob Deese then struck out a pair in 2 scoreless innings pitched.

Bradenton doubles up Lakeland

Low-A Bradenton doubled up the Lakeland Flying Tigers 4-2 on Saturday night. With the win, the Marauders are now 19-13 this season.

J.P. Massey started for Bradenton and continued to pitch well. In 5 scoreless innings pitched Massey allowed two hits, walked a pair, and struck out nine. Massey now owns a 3.47 ERA in 23.1 innings pitched this season.

Luis Peralta pitched 3 innings. Peralta allowed 2 runs, 1 earned, on two hits, a walk, and six strikeouts. Elijah Birdsong pitched hte 9th inning. Birdsong fired a 1-2-3 inning with a pair of strikeouts.

Serving as the team's designated hitter, Shalin Polanco was 1-for-3 with a walk and a solo home run. This gives Polanco 4 home runs this season. Enmanuel Terrero was 1-for-2 with a run score, RBI, and two walks.

Alexander Mojica hit his 3rd home run of the season. This was his lone hit of the night, as he went 1-for-3 with a walk, a run scored, and two RBI.
